AMENDMENT TO HOUSE BILL 4486

2    AMENDMENT NO. ______. Amend House Bill 4486 by replacing
3everything after the enacting clause with the following:
 
4    "Section 5. The Illinois Grant Funds Recovery Act is
5amended by adding Section 11.5 as follows:
 
6    (30 ILCS 705/11.5 new)
7    Sec. 11.5. Contract performance metrics.
8    (a) Consistent with the objectives of budgeting for
9outcomes, as soon as practicable after the effective date of
10this amendatory Act of the 98th General Assembly, each grantor
11agency, in coordination with the Governor's Office of
12Management and Budget, shall undertake a review of its
13contracts and grants to assess which contracts and grants, and
14categories thereof, are appropriate candidates for the
15implementation of a performance-based contract evaluation
16model.

 

 

09800HB4486sam001- 2 -LRB098 17632 JWD 59641 a

1    (b) Each grantor agency shall refine current performance
2metrics and develop new metrics for programs, including
3contracts and grants that fall within the categories determined
4to be appropriate by the Governor's Office of Management and
5Budget and the grantor agency under subsection (a) of this
6Section. Performance metrics may be based on required program
7components and a methodology that incorporates the reasonable
8costs of the required program components.
9    (c) Beginning in State Fiscal Year 2016, each grantor
10agency shall ensure that service contracts and agreements, as
11deemed appropriate under subsection (a) of this Section,
12include performance reporting requirements.
13    (d) Each grantor agency shall enhance its processes to
14monitor and address noncompliance with reporting requirements
15and with program performance standards. Where applicable, the
16process may include a corrective action plan. The monitoring
17process shall include a plan for tracking and documenting
18performance-based contracting decisions.
19    (e) Notwithstanding any other provision of this Act, the
20provisions of this Section apply to all contracts and grants
21subject to this Act.
22    (f) Nothing in this Section is applicable to grants
23authorized under the General Obligation Bond Act or the Build
24Illinois Bond Act.
